Iginio (or Igino) Ugo Tarchetti (Italian pronunciation: [iˈdʒinjo ˈuɡo tarˈketti]; 29 June 1839 – 25 March 1869) was an Italian author, poet, and journalist of the first generation of Lombard line. Long forgotten by Italian literary critics, Tarchetti's work is undergoing critical reappraisal in recent years. Tarchetti is considered the first practitioner of Gothic fiction in Italy.
